Hydrant GIS To Deliver Better Service"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<p class=\"has-drop-cap\">Fire hydrants are designed in a way so that it allows people to have access to water supply in case a fire breaks out.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Often placed in a strategically visible location, it is essential for fire hydrants to be in good condition and to be upgraded from time to time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>That being said, members of the public should always be aware of where their nearest location of fire hydrants are at their neighbourhood.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In line with the Industrial Revolution 4.0 (IR4.0), a Fire Hydrant Geographic Information System (GIS) was developed to locate the exact locations of water hydrants.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Developed using QGIS open-source software and Google MyMaps, the Fire Hydrant GIS is a result of a strategic collaboration between the Fire and Rescue Department of Malaysia Sarawak and <em>Polyteknik Kuching<\/em>, Sarawak.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cThis is indeed a wise move as we are using technology to carry out our tasks and delivering excellent emergency services to the public,\u201d said Malaysia Fire and Rescue Department director-general Dato\u2019 Sri Ts Mohamad Hamdan handed 10 units of Mitsubishi Triton utility to Sarawak Fire and Rescue Department<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<\/div>\n\n\n<p>He added that it is also a new improvement as previously the fire and rescue department would use a close system in which it does not utilise Google system and is not compatible with the evolution of information and communication technology (ICT).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The Fire Hydrant GIS is a GIS -based fire hydrant and open-source management system that serves the purpose of supporting the acquisition, storage, processing, analysis and display of spatial data.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The system allows the management of data distribution on fire hydrants to be more efficient and effective.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Dato\u2019 Sri Ts Mohamad Hamdan noted that the effective data sharing will provide fire hydrant analysis, which among others, will assist in navigating the fire hydrant at the location of emergency events.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cThe system will enable firefighters to identify and gather input and data on fire hydrants throughout Sarawak as water hydrants is a powerful tool to combat fire emergencies,\u201d he said.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In using the system, it stores water hydrants analysis which includes locations, total number, status among others as well as allow navigation to the scene of emergencies.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Aside from that, fire records are kept centrally to facilitate the generation of statistics and fire case studies.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To date, there are now 2.5 million fire hydrants throughout Malaysia in which
